Job Description Overview The client I am working with is a growing, dynamic consulting firm working extensively to support financial institutions. They are looking for a highly experienced ESG director to join the team to manage growth and delivery on projects. This is a unique opportunity for an ESG leader to accelerate growth in ESG. This role offers a generous salary and benefits, depending on experience. Responsibilities As the Project Director, you will be responsible for overseeing the plan and delivery of multiple projects. You will define project goals, objectives, and deliverables, ensuring alignment with company strategy. You will have a proven track record of working effectively on international projects, on behalf of developers and investors. You will be highly skilled at the execution of ESG projects.
